On the 10<sup>th<\/sup> of April 1691, a fire broke out in the palace destroying the old structures and artwork. This second blaze destroyed most of the remaining residential and governmental buildings.\r\n\r\nThe <strong>Whitehall Palace fire of 1698<\/strong> was a catastrophic event that destroyed much of what was once the largest and most magnificent royal residence in <a title=\"England\" href=\"https:\/\/www.earth-site.co.uk\/Education\/england\">England<\/a>. Located in Westminster, <strong>Whitehall Palace<\/strong> had served as the main residence of English monarchs since the reign of <strong>Henry VIII<\/strong>, who acquired and expanded the site in the early 16th century. By the time of the fire, Whitehall was a sprawling complex of over 1,500 rooms, renowned for its grandeur and its role as a centre of political and cultural life in <a title=\"United Kingdom\" href=\"https:\/\/www.earth-site.co.uk\/Education\/united-kingdom\">Britain<\/a>.\r\n\r\nThe fire broke out on the night of <strong>January 4, 1698<\/strong>, reportedly starting in a linen room adjacent to a fireplace. The blaze quickly spread through the largely wooden structures of the palace, fueled by high winds and the lack of effective firefighting methods. Despite the efforts of fire crews and residents to contain it, the fire consumed most of the palace complex, including the famous Banqueting House, designed by the celebrated architect <strong>Inigo Jones<\/strong>, which miraculously survived the disaster.\r\n\r\nThe destruction of Whitehall Palace marked the end of its prominence as a royal residence. By the late 17th century, the palace had already fallen into disrepair, and King <strong>William III<\/strong> preferred the comforts of <strong>Kensington Palace<\/strong> and <strong>Hampton Court<\/strong>. After the fire, the remnants of Whitehall were not rebuilt, and the royal court was permanently relocated to other residences.\r\n\r\nThe fire also had a lasting impact on the urban landscape of London. Today, the site of Whitehall Palace is occupied by government buildings, and only the Banqueting House remains as a testament to its former splendour. The Banqueting House is particularly significant because it was the site of the execution of <strong>King Charles I<\/strong> in 1649, an event that remains one of the most dramatic moments in British history.\r\n\r\nThe fire of 1698 effectively ended an era for Whitehall Palace, but its legacy endures in British history as a symbol of royal power and architectural achievement. The Banqueting House stands as a reminder of the palace\u2019s former glory and a witness to pivotal events in the nation's past.<\/span><\/dd><dd><span class=\"tdih_event_year\">1950<\/span>  <span class=\"tdih_event_name\"><strong>In 1951<\/strong>\u00a0<a title=\"China\" href=\"https:\/\/www.earth-site.co.uk\/Education\/china\">Chinese<\/a>\u00a0and\u00a0<a title=\"North Korea\" href=\"https:\/\/www.earth-site.co.uk\/Education\/north-korea\">North Korean<\/a> troops were said to be close to capturing the <a title=\"South Korea\" href=\"https:\/\/www.earth-site.co.uk\/Education\/south-korea\">South Korean<\/a> capital city of Seoul for a second time since the war began. South Korea was invaded by the North Korean People\u2019s Army (NKPA) in June 1950, but after UN intervention they had been forced back into their own country and pursued by UN Forces. When the NKPA\u2019s defeat seemed certain the Chinese Communist Forces (CFF) joined the North Korean forces for this counter-strike. UN forces regained control of Seoul in March 1951. After many failed attempts at peace talks, a demilitarised zone was set up between the two countries which still exists today.<\/span><\/dd><dd><span class=\"tdih_event_year\">1958<\/span>  <span class=\"tdih_event_name\"><strong>In 1958<\/strong>\u00a0the first spacecraft to orbit the\u00a0<a title=\"Planet Earth\" href=\"https:\/\/www.earth-site.co.uk\/Education\/planet-earth\">Earth<\/a>\u00a0(<a title=\"Russia\" href=\"https:\/\/www.earth-site.co.uk\/Education\/russia\">Russia<\/a>\u2019s Sputnik 1) burnt up on its re-entry into our atmosphere after orbiting Earth for 3 months.<\/span><\/dd><dd><span class=\"tdih_event_year\">1958<\/span>  <span class=\"tdih_event_name\"><strong>In 1958<\/strong>\u00a0Sir Edmund Hillary,\u00a0<a title=\"United Kingdom\" href=\"https:\/\/www.earth-site.co.uk\/Education\/united-kingdom\">British<\/a> Explorer, reached the South Pole. It has been 46 years since anyone managed an overland crossing to the most southern point on <a title=\"Planet Earth\" href=\"https:\/\/www.earth-site.co.uk\/Education\/planet-earth\">Earth<\/a>. The last explorer was Captain Robert Scott and his team in 1912.<\/span><\/dd><dd><span class=\"tdih_event_year\">2000<\/span>  <span class=\"tdih_event_name\"><strong>In 2000<\/strong>\u00a0Catherine Hartly became the first\u00a0<a title=\"United Kingdom\" href=\"https:\/\/www.earth-site.co.uk\/Education\/united-kingdom\">British<\/a>\u00a0woman to cross\u00a0<a title=\"Antarctica\" href=\"https:\/\/www.earth-site.co.uk\/Education\/antarctica\">Antarctica<\/a> by land and reach the South Pole. Her team travelled 1,094 km or 680 miles to get the most southern point on\u00a0<a title=\"Planet Earth\"
